返回

程序猿的福音:如何高效应对线上故障?

前端

应对突如其来的网站故障

当网站突然崩溃时,任何人都可能会感到不知所措和沮丧。网站是企业和个人形象和品牌的关键组成部分。因此,重要的是了解在面对意外故障时采取的有效步骤。在本文中,我们将探讨八个提示,帮助您快速有效地解决网站故障,恢复您的网站并最大程度减少影响。

1. 识别早期预警信号

就像任何问题一样,网站故障通常在发生之前会出现一些预警信号。请注意网站行为的变化,例如加载速度减慢、页面显示异常或功能失常。识别这些早期迹象至关重要,因为它使您有时间采取预防措施并防止潜在的重大问题。

2. 扮演侦探

一旦您意识到网站存在问题,立即采取行动找出根本原因至关重要。检查服务器日志、分析错误模式并收集有关故障的任何其他相关信息。通过采取侦探式的方法,您可以缩小搜索范围并准确识别问题的根源。

3. 隔离问题

有时,网站故障只会影响特定页面或部分。在这些情况下,重要的是隔离问题区域。这有助于您专注于受影响的组件,并避免浪费时间检查整个网站。通过隔离问题,您可以更有效地解决故障并恢复正常功能。

4. 实施临时解决方案

在解决根本原因的同时,实施临时解决方案至关重要,以减少故障对用户体验的影响。这可能涉及禁用有问题的功能、将流量重定向到网站的其他部分,或者提供替代访问渠道。通过提供临时解决方案,您可以减轻故障的影响,并让用户在永久修复完成之前继续使用网站。

5. 优先处理问题

并非所有网站故障都是平等的。有些问题可能是灾难性的,需要立即修复,而其他问题可能只是不便,可以稍后再修复。对故障进行优先级排序有助于您专注于最重要的任务,并根据其严重性分配资源。

6. 团队沟通

在解决网站故障时,有效的团队沟通至关重要。确保开发、IT 和业务团队之间存在清晰的沟通渠道。通过保持团队成员的最新状态并协调他们的工作,您可以加快故障排除过程,并防止沟通不畅导致延误。

7. 测试和记录

在实施修复后,彻底测试网站以确保问题已完全解决至关重要。执行全面测试后,记录修复步骤和解决方案。通过记录修复过程,您可以创建知识库,以便在将来出现类似问题时参考,从而提高未来的故障排除效率。

8. 从错误中吸取教训

网站故障是一个学习机会。利用这次机会分析错误的原因并识别改进领域。考虑实施主动监控系统或定期执行压力测试,以降低未来发生故障的风险。通过积极主动地从错误中学习,您可以提高网站的弹性并防止类似问题再次发生。

结论

网站故障可能会令人沮丧,但了解适当的步骤可以使您快速有效地恢复网站并最大程度地减少影响。通过识别早期预警信号、调查根本原因、实施临时解决方案、优先处理问题、有效沟通、测试和记录修复,您可以驾驭故障排除过程,保持网站正常运行并为用户提供积极的体验。

常见问题解答

1. 我应该多久检查一次我的网站是否有故障?

定期检查网站是否有故障至关重要,但频率取决于网站的规模和重要性。对于关键网站,建议每天进行一次检查,而对于较小的网站,每周一次的检查就足够了。

2. 如何自动化网站故障检测?

可以使用各种工具和服务来自动化网站故障检测。这些工具可以定期监视您的网站,并在检测到问题时向您发送警报。

3. 我应该将哪些错误视为高优先级?

高优先级的错误包括导致网站完全不可用或严重影响用户体验的错误。这些错误应立即修复。

4. 我如何防止网站故障?

虽然无法完全防止网站故障,但可以采取措施降低风险。这些措施包括实施主动监控系统、定期执行压力测试、使用可靠的主机提供商以及保持网站软件的最新状态。

5. 我如何从网站故障中恢复?

从网站故障中恢复包括调查根本原因、实施修复、测试网站并恢复正常操作。